The Science Behind Skin Mapping
Skin mapping, also referred to as face mapping, is rooted in both Eastern and Western medicine. Standard Chinese medicine and Ayurveda have long identified the link between face skin and internal wellness, associating details trouble locations with imbalances in the body. At the same time, contemporary dermatology recognizes that skin problems can originate from diet, stress and anxiety, hormone variations, and way of living routines. By finding out how to interpret these facial signs, you can adjust your skincare regular and everyday habits to advertise a healthier skin tone.

Chin and Jawline: Hormonal Fluctuations
Outbreaks along the chin and jawline commonly point to hormonal inequalities, specifically during menstrual cycles or times of raised stress and anxiety. This is why lots of people experience flare-ups in this area prior to their period. Supporting hormone balance via a nutrient-dense diet plan, stress monitoring, and a well-shaped skincare routine can aid keep these outbreaks in check.
